<p><strong>favorite thing:</strong><br />
<em>stovetop popcorn</em><strong><br />
3tbl olive oil<br />
1/3-1/2c popcorn kernels<br />
natures seasoning/seasoning salt</p>
<p>in heavy bottom stock pot, heat 3 tbl of olive oil on medium heat with 2 or 3 popcorn kernels in there. put the lid on, but tilt it so it is vented and allows the steam out.<br />
when you hear the popcorn pop, the oil is ready. pour in the rest of the kernels, put cover on fully, and shake pan around to coat the popcorn kernels with oil and evenly distribute them. return to the heat, and vent/tilt the lid again.<br />
wait for your popcorn to pop, removing from heat when it slows down popping.<br />
pour into a big bowl, shake on some natures seasoning, toss, eat and enjoy!<br />

<strong>chicken tortilla soup recipe</strong><br />
1 can kidney beans<br />
1 can black beans<br />
1 can whole kernal corn<br />
1 can diced tomatoes with green chilis<br />
1 box chicken broth<br />
6oz enchilada sauce<br />
4 frozen chicken breasts<br />
1tbls minced garlic<br />
chopped onions (if you&#8217;d like)<br />
1tbls cumin<br />
sour cream<br />
shredded cheddar cheese<br />
tortilla chips</p>
<p>1. put first 10 ingredients into the crock pot in the morning. set on low and cook for 8 hours<br />
2. take out chicken breasts and shred or chop, put back into the soup<br />
3. serve topped with a dab of sour cream, some cheese, and some crushed tortilla chips finish it.<br />
yummers!<br />
freezes well. makes a ton. tastes even better the second day!</p>
